Hotel Pasatiempo is a charming bed & breakfast in Playa Tamarindo just 5 minutes walk to the beach in the quiet part of town.

The hotel features a central pool area with a natural stone and teak deck, and a full service bar/restaurant “Monkey La-La” in a natural palm rancho.

The hotel is situated in a luxuriant tropical garden beneath the shade of hardwood, palm and mango trees. All of the rooms feature high efficiency AC and hot water, flat screen televisions with cable, comfy orthopedic mattresses, safe box, and a clock radio.

Rates do not include government taxes (13%). Rates are based on double occupancy. For a triple occupancy add $20.00 + taxes. Children up to 3 years old are free of charge. Children 3 to 9 years old $10.00; and 10 years old and older pay as adults. Rates or taxes are subject to change without previous notice.
Visa, MasterCard, AmericanExpress
PETS are not allowed at the hotel.
